Sports Betting Market

Sports betting has gained popularity in the Republic of Congo over recent years, and we've observed growing participation despite infrastructure challenges. Football dominates the betting landscape, with Les Diables Rouges (the Red Devils - national team) generating significant betting interest during Africa Cup of Nations tournaments and World Cup qualifiers.

The domestic Congo Premier League attracts local betting interest, though European leagues like the French Ligue 1, English Premier League, and Spanish La Liga generate higher betting volumes due to superior media coverage and perceived higher quality. Our research shows that mobile betting is the dominant form of access, with smartphones far more common than desktop computers for gambling.

Basketball has a growing following in Congo, with both NBA and local competitions attracting bets. Handball is also popular, reflecting Congo's success in the sport at African level.

Online Casino Gaming

Online casino gaming is available to Congolese players through international platforms. Classic table games like roulette, blackjack, and baccarat are accessible, along with extensive slot game libraries. French-language casino games are particularly well-received given Congo's Francophone status.

Land-based casinos exist in Brazzaville and Pointe-Noire, primarily serving expatriates and international visitors. However, the online sector offers greater accessibility and game variety for local players.

Live Dealer Options

Live casino games have gained popularity among Congolese players seeking authentic casino experiences. International platforms offer live dealer games streamed in real-time, including multiple variants of bl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and game shows.

French-speaking dealers are a significant advantage for Congolese players. Evolution Gaming and Pragmatic Play Live are the most common providers we've seen available, though internet speed limitations in some areas can affect the live streaming experience.

Payment Methods

Payment processing for online gambling in Congo presents challenges but has improved in recent years. The Central African CFA franc (XAF) is not widely supported by international gambling sites, requiring currency conversion for most transactions.

Available payment methods include:

  • Mobile money: Airtel Money and MTN Mobile Money are popular in Congo, but integration with international gambling sites remains limited.
  • Cryptocurrencies: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Tether are increasingly used due to their borderless nature and fast processing.
  • E-wallets: Skrill, Neteller, and Perfect Money work with many international operators.
  • Credit/debit cards: Visa and Mastercard acceptance varies by operator and card issuer.
  • Bank transfers: International transfers are possible but slow and expensive.
The lack of seamless mobile money integration remains a barrier to market growth, as mobile money is the preferred payment method for many Congolese consumers.

Regulatory Framework

The Republic of Congo does not have comprehensive online gambling regulations as of 2026. The existing legal framework primarily addresses land-based gambling operations. Online gambling exists in a legal grey area, with no specific laws explicitly permitting or prohibiting it.

We haven't found evidence of government efforts to block international gambling sites or prosecute players for using offshore platforms. However, the lack of regulation means no consumer protections, licensing standards, or responsible gambling frameworks specific to Congo.

The legal gambling age is 18 years. In our opinion, Congo could benefit from developing a modern regulatory framework that licenses operators, generates tax revenue, and implements consumer protection measures.

Responsible Gambling

The Republic of Congo lacks dedicated responsible gambling resources and support services. The absence of comprehensive regulation means player protection infrastructure is minimal.

Players must rely on tools provided by international operators:

  • Deposit and loss limits
  • Self-exclusion programs
  • Session time reminders
  • Links to international support organizations
French-language resources from organizations like Gambling Therapy provide some support, but local context and culturally appropriate interventions are lacking. We believe that as the market continues to grow, developing responsible gambling frameworks and support services should be a priority.
